/*-------------------------------------------------------------------------
 *
 * itup.h
 *	  POSTGRES index tuple definitions.
 *
 *
 * Portions Copyright (c) 1996-2003, PostgreSQL Global Development Group
 * Portions Copyright (c) 1994, Regents of the University of California
 *
 * $Id: itup.h,v 1.38 2003/08/04 02:40:10 momjian Exp $
 *
 *-------------------------------------------------------------------------
 */
#ifndef ITUP_H
#define ITUP_H

#include "access/ibit.h"
#include "access/tupdesc.h"
#include "access/tupmacs.h"
#include "storage/itemptr.h"


typedef struct IndexTupleData
{
	ItemPointerData t_tid;		/* reference TID to heap tuple */

	/* ---------------
	 * t_info is layed out in the following fashion:
	 *
	 * 15th (high) bit: has nulls
	 * 14th bit: has var-width attributes
	 * 13th bit: unused
	 * 12-0 bit: size of tuple
	 * ---------------
	 */

	unsigned short t_info;		/* various info about tuple */

	/*
	 * please make sure sizeof(IndexTupleData) is MAXALIGN'ed. See
	 * IndexInfoFindDataOffset() for the reason.
	 */

} IndexTupleData;				/* MORE DATA FOLLOWS AT END OF STRUCT */

typedef IndexTupleData *IndexTuple;


typedef struct InsertIndexResultData
{
	ItemPointerData pointerData;
} InsertIndexResultData;

typedef InsertIndexResultData *InsertIndexResult;


/* ----------------
 *		externs
 * ----------------
 */

#define INDEX_SIZE_MASK 0x1FFF
#define INDEX_NULL_MASK 0x8000
#define INDEX_VAR_MASK	0x4000
/* bit 0x2000 is not used */

#define IndexTupleSize(itup)		((Size) (((IndexTuple) (itup))->t_info & INDEX_SIZE_MASK))
#define IndexTupleDSize(itup)		((Size) ((itup).t_info & INDEX_SIZE_MASK))
#define IndexTupleHasNulls(itup)	((((IndexTuple) (itup))->t_info & INDEX_NULL_MASK))
#define IndexTupleHasVarwidths(itup) ((((IndexTuple) (itup))->t_info & INDEX_VAR_MASK))
